| package org.apache.cassandra.db.marshal; |
| |
| import java.nio.ByteBuffer; |
| |
| import org.apache.cassandra.cql3.Duration; |
| |
| /** |
| * Base type for temporal types (timestamp, date ...). |
| * |
| */ |
| public abstract class TemporalType<T> extends AbstractType<T> |
| { |
| protected TemporalType(ComparisonType comparisonType) |
| { |
| super(comparisonType); |
| } |
| |
| /** |
| * Returns the current temporal value. |
| * @return the current temporal value. |
| */ |
| public ByteBuffer now() |
| { |
| return fromTimeInMillis(System.currentTimeMillis()); |
| } |
| |
| /** |
| * Converts this temporal in UNIX timestamp. |
| * @param value the temporal value. |
| * @return the UNIX timestamp corresponding to this temporal. |
| */ |
| public long toTimeInMillis(ByteBuffer value) |
| { |
| throw new UnsupportedOperationException(); |
| } |
| |
| /** |
| * Returns the temporal value corresponding to the specified UNIX timestamp. |
| * @param timeInMillis the UNIX timestamp to convert |
| * @return the temporal value corresponding to the specified UNIX timestamp |
| */ |
| public ByteBuffer fromTimeInMillis(long timeInMillis) |
| { |
| throw new UnsupportedOperationException(); |
| } |
| |
| /** |
| * Adds the duration to the specified value. |
| * |
| * @param temporal the value to add to |
| * @param duration the duration to add |
| * @return the addition result |
| */ |
| public ByteBuffer addDuration(ByteBuffer temporal, |
| ByteBuffer duration) |
| { |
| long timeInMillis = toTimeInMillis(temporal); |
| Duration d = DurationType.instance.compose(duration); |
| validateDuration(d); |
| return fromTimeInMillis(d.addTo(timeInMillis)); |
| } |
| |
| /** |
| * Substract the duration from the specified value. |
| * |
| * @param temporal the value to substract from |
| * @param duration the duration to substract |
| * @return the substracion result |
| */ |
| public ByteBuffer substractDuration(ByteBuffer temporal, |
| ByteBuffer duration) |
| { |
| long timeInMillis = toTimeInMillis(temporal); |
| Duration d = DurationType.instance.compose(duration); |
| validateDuration(d); |
| return fromTimeInMillis(d.substractFrom(timeInMillis)); |
| } |
| |
| /** |
| * Validates that the duration has the correct precision. |
| * @param duration the duration to validate. |
| */ |
| protected void validateDuration(Duration duration) |
| { |
| } |
| } |
